Akshay Kumar economizes for Sajid Nadiadwala's 'Housefull'

Since Akshay Kumar pays all his taxes diligently, it is safe and secure to state that his market price is Rs. 30 crores per movie. But he's also aware of the recession around him. Therefore when his wife and child flew in to London to join him earlier this week, Akshay insisted on paying for their air tickets.

Says Akshay, "Sajid is an old friend. And even if he wasn't, I know exactly how difficult it is for a producer to keep the budget in check. During all the years that I've been in the industry, I've observed what a thankless task it is for producers to meet up the demands of the project and the people involved with the project."

Adds a source, "Producer Sajid Nadiadwala insisted it was a very small amount and part of the crew's travel expenses. But Akshay insisted. He won't burden his producer with extra expenditure at all, though he will charge his market price."

Confirming this price, a producer says, "Akshay does charge Rs. 30 crores. No doubt about it. But beyond that there are no extra costs at all. Akshay pays for the expenses that occur during shooting."

In fact our 30-crore hero who has just delivered another success 'Kambakkht Ishq' decided to economize for the same producer when they reunited for another film 'Housefull' in London.

Instead of putting up at the posh St. James Hotel where Amitabh Bachchan and other A-listers from Bollywood stay when shooting in London, Akshay chose the posh but nevertheless far less expensive Hotel Cumberland, although the producer insisted Akshay to stay at the more expensive place.

Says Akshay, "No, I always prefer to stay with the rest of the unit. It always creates a feeling of unity among the crew. In fact my wife and son have just joined me in London. They're staying at Cumberland with me."
